Miranorte has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 77°F (25°C). Winters average 77°F in January while summers reach 75°F in July / relatively mild seasonal variation. The area gets 216 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 66.4 inches (wetter than the 38-inch national average). The city sits at an elevation of 738 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 77°F (25°C) 10.6 in Wettest
February 77°F (25°C) 10.0 in
March 77°F (25°C) 10.2 in
April 77°F (25°C) 6.5 in
May 77°F (25°C) 1.5 in
June 75°F (24°C) 0.3 in
July 75°F (24°C) 0.2 in Coldest, Driest
August 78°F (26°C) 0.3 in
September 80°F (26°C) 2.2 in Warmest
October 79°F (26°C) 6.5 in
November 77°F (25°C) 8.3 in
December 77°F (25°C) 9.9 in

Miranorte has a seasonal temperature swing of 4°F / from 75°F in July to 80°F in September. Total annual precipitation is 66.4 inches, with January being the wettest month (10.6") and July the driest (0.2").
